Output 21b158804fad8b903c2841ce244ed7ade7a4fac62b085b3a004a7d6f4d830307:2

value
645886
script pubkey
OP_0 OP_PUSHBYTES_20 2e1ff171b015e166ba6ed9b7b3b0478cb9241b6f
address
bc1q9c0lzudszhskdwnwmxmm8vz83jujgxm0unm97s
transaction
21b158804fad8b903c2841ce244ed7ade7a4fac62b085b3a004a7d6f4d830307
spent
true